2. Scene Free
The direct edition includes Scene Free with no account and no time limit. Scene Free can hold up to four user-created saved scenes at once. Automatic safety states and the temporary onboarding practice do not consume that allowance.
At the limit, you may return to, rename, inspect, or delete existing local scenes. Deleting one frees a slot for another capture; activating Scene Pro unlocks unlimited saved scenes. Scene does not delete or upload captured work when you reach the Free limit or deactivate Pro.

4. Versions and updates
The personal-license offer includes Scene 1.x and new releases made available during the 12 months after purchase. The build and features you are licensed to use remain licensed after that period. A future major version may be a paid upgrade; buying it is optional.
Compatibility maintenance depends on changes in macOS and third-party apps. We may discontinue support for older macOS releases after reasonable notice. We do not promise that every third-party app will remain automatable indefinitely.

6. Product boundaries
Scene is a work-continuity utility, not backup, version control, disaster recovery, or a virtual machine snapshot. Specifically:
- Live Resume depends on the original app process and identifiable windows still existing.
- Resource Rebuild is best effort and supports only documented apps and resource types.
- Scene cannot generally restore unsaved third-party app memory, historical file contents, arbitrary internal selections, running terminal commands, macOS Spaces, or every full-screen layout.
- App updates or macOS changes may temporarily affect window identification or automation.
You remain responsible for saving files, maintaining backups, reviewing a rebuild preview, and verifying results before relying on restored work.
